Output e43031a42b286668c526d3401178badb8852035a36719da98a211898397195af:1

value
2541280
script pubkey
OP_0 OP_PUSHBYTES_20 760836b95bb54d7bf15c6753dc2b1b87b4eebf54
address
ltc1qwcyrdw2mk4xhhu2uvafac2cms76wa065ly54sy
transaction
e43031a42b286668c526d3401178badb8852035a36719da98a211898397195af
spent
true